COLUMBUS, OH, January 23,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a recognized creator of ground-breaking tv series, happily announces its newest documentary series, "New Frontiers," showcasing the pioneering triumphs of Andelyn Biosciences. This particular documentary will investigate the innovative strides produced by Andelyn Biosciences, a top g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the developing space of biotechnology.
"New Frontiers" is a stimulating series carefully created to discover revolutionary institutions that are at the top of molding the future of medical care across the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and available on on-demand via different plat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.
Planet TV Studios is delighted to have Gina Grad returning as their host. Gina is an established author, podcast host, and radio personality primarily based in Los Angeles, California. She formerly served as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ina also has an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Coupled with her broadcasting profession, she is the author of "My Extra Mom," a children's book crafted to support kids and stepparents in navigating the difficulties of blended families.
Through the intricate industry of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has emerged as a innovator, advancing revolutionary therapies and contributing substantially to the biopharmaceutical business. Founded in 2020, the company,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, begun out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ute having a vision to speeding up the evolution and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Viral Vectors
Microbes have developed to effectively introduce DNA sequences into host c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Frequently employed biological delivery agents include:
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both dividing and non-dividing cells but can elicit immunogenic reactions.
Parvovirus-based carriers – Preferred due to their reduced immune response and potential to ensure prolonged DNA transcription.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Integrate into the cellular DNA,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for modifying quiescent cells.
Non-Viral Vectors
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These comprise:
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ating genetic sequences for targeted internalization.
Electroporation – Applying electric shocks to open transient channels in cell membranes,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.
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Addressing Inherited Diseases
Numerous inherited conditions stem from monogenic defects, positioning them as prime subjects for genetic correction. Key developments include:
Cystic Fibrosis – Studies focusing on delivering functional CFTR genes are showing promising results.
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ials aim to restore the production of clotting factors.
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-driven genetic correction delivers promise for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ies seek to repair red blood cell abnormalities.
Oncological Genetic Treatment
Gene therapy plays a vital role in tumor management, either by modifying immune cells to eliminate cancerous growths or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to halt metastasis. Key innovative tumor-targeted genetic solutions feature:
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Modified lymphocytes targeting specific cancer antigens.
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Bioengineered viral entities that selectively infect and destroy tumor cells.
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Reestablishing the efficacy of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.
Treatment of Contagious Illnesses
DNA-based therapy provides possible therapies for chronic infections such as AIDS-related infection. Developmental strategies comprise:
CRISPR-Based HIV Therapy – Aiming at and destroying viral-laden units.
Gene Editing of Immunocytes – Rendering White blood cells resistant to HIV entry.

The Science Behind Cell and Gene Therapies
Cell Therapy: Utilizing Regenerative Cellular Potential
Tissue restoration techniques utilizes the renewal abilities of cellular functions to combat ailments. Leading cases illustrate:
Stem Cell Infusion Therapy:
Used to restore blood cell function in patients through renewal of blood-forming cells via matched cellular replacements.
CAR-T Immunotherapy: A transformative tumor-targeting approach in which a individual’s white blood cells are tailored to eliminate and eliminate neoplastic cells.
Multipotent Stromal Cell Therapy: Studied for its therapeutic value in addressing self-attacking conditions, bone and joint injuries, and neurological diseases.
Genetic Engineering Solutions: Altering the Fundamental Biology
Gene therapy works by adjusting the underlying problem of inherited disorders:
In-Body Gene Treatment: Injects DNA sequences inside the individual’s system, like the government-sanctioned vision-restoring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.
External Genetic Modification: Utilizes editing a individual’s tissues outside the body and then implanting them, as applied in some clinical trials for red blood cell disorders and compromised immunity.
The advent of precision DNA-editing has dramatically improved gene therapy studies, enabling accurate changes at the chromosomal sequences.
Transformative Applications in Medicine
Cell and gene therapies are transforming medical approaches throughout medical disciplines:
Tumor Therapies
The endorsement of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Kymriah have a peek here and Yescarta has revolutionized the oncology field, particularly for patients with certain types of blood cancers who have failed standard treatments.
Genetic Disorders
Disorders including SMA as well as sickle cell disease, that until recently offered restricted care possibilities, as of today have innovative DNA-based therapies such as a gene replacement this contact form therapy alongside Casgevy.
Neurological Ailments
DNA-based treatment is being explored as a solution for brain deterioration diseases for instance a movement disorder and a hereditary brain disorder, as numerous therapeutic investigations showing hopeful successes.
